What Is the Citizen CL-S700III?

The Citizen CL-S700III is an industrial-grade barcode and label printer designed for demanding business environments. It supports both direct thermal and thermal transfer printing, allowing organizations to produce a wide range of labels for different applications.

Dual Printing Technology

One of the biggest advantages of the printer is its support for two printing methods.

Direct Thermal Printing

This method produces labels without requiring ribbons.

Ideal applications include:

  • Shipping labels

  • Receipts

  • Temporary identification labels

  • Short-term logistics

Advantages include:

  • Lower supply costs

  • Faster media replacement

  • Simplified operation

Thermal Transfer Printing

Thermal transfer printing creates long-lasting labels using ribbons.

Suitable applications include:

  • Product identification

  • Asset tracking

  • Manufacturing labels

  • Compliance labels

  • Chemical labeling

These labels resist:

  • Heat

  • Moisture

  • Chemicals

  • Abrasion

Businesses requiring durable labels benefit greatly from this technology.
